The MP2481DH-LF-Z is a voltage regulator IC that converts an input voltage into a regulated output voltage. It utilizes a switching regulator topology to achieve high efficiency. The input voltage is first stepped down and then regulated to provide a stable output voltage. The IC incorporates various protection features to ensure safe operation.

Question: What is the input voltage range for MP2481DH-LF-Z?
Answer: The input voltage range for MP2481DH-LF-Z is 4.5V to 75V.
Question: What is the maximum output current of MP2481DH-LF-Z?
Answer: The maximum output current of MP2481DH-LF-Z is 3A.
Question: Can MP2481DH-LF-Z be used in automotive applications?
Answer: Yes, MP2481DH-LF-Z is suitable for automotive applications.
Question: What is the switching frequency range of MP2481DH-LF-Z?
Answer: The switching frequency range of MP2481DH-LF-Z is 100kHz to 2.2MHz.
Question: Does MP2481DH-LF-Z have overcurrent protection?
Answer: Yes, MP2481DH-LF-Z features overcurrent protection.
Question: Is MP2481DH-LF-Z compatible with both synchronous and non-synchronous rectification?
Answer: Yes, MP2481DH-LF-Z is compatible with both synchronous and non-synchronous rectification.
Question: What type of package does MP2481DH-LF-Z come in?
Answer: MP2481DH-LF-Z is available in a QFN-16 (3x3mm) package.
Question: Can MP2481DH-LF-Z operate in a wide temperature range?
Answer: Yes, MP2481DH-LF-Z can operate in a wide temperature range from -40°C to 125°C.
Question: Does MP2481DH-LF-Z have built-in thermal shutdown protection?
Answer: Yes, MP2481DH-LF-Z includes built-in thermal shutdown protection.
Question: What are the typical applications for MP2481DH-LF-Z?
Answer: Typical applications for MP2481DH-LF-Z include industrial power supplies, automotive systems, and LED lighting.
